1980 Nissan 280zx trouble

My husband and I have just bought a 1980 Nissan 280zx. We are having a
really hard time
figuring out what is wrong with it. The car had new spark plugs,
wires, belts, and new injectors when purchased. We have since replaced
the radiator, water pump, valve cover gasket, fuel filter, PVC valve,
and alternator due to over heating. Now there is another problem.
The car runs fine until it reaches about 25rpm's (about 50 mph) and
then wants to bog down, like maybe it's not getting enough gas, or
slipping out of gear, or I've been told is maybe a safety device that
is trying to protect the engine. At first the car only did this when
warm but is doing it more now. We have cleaned the distributor
(thought to have moisture in it). We've been told several things that
could be wrong from: AFM, sylnoid swith,cold start valve, oxygen
sensor, and so on but were hoping someone can try to narrow down where
to actually start or what may be causing the problem.
